Default Tranny problem

I have a built 4l60e with about 4000 miles on it. I took the car out last week for about a 40 min. ride and had absolutely no problems with it. I ended up having to take the car to work today which is about a ten min. drive and the tranny was running like ****.

First off I was criusing at about 40 mph and if I would give it more gas the rpm would come up but the car wouldn't move any faster ( almost as if I was in neutral). Next I tried putting the peddle to the floor to see what would happen and the car would downshift an take off pretty good but then end up bouncing off the rev limiter.

The only other thing I noticed was ussually my tranny temp. on the highway is about 100 to 120 degrees and on back roads it is about 140 to 160 degrees. During these issues today It was running at about 180 degrees and rising before I got to work.

It took a long time but finally found out it was my 3-4 clutches that were shot. He also told me that it almost took him a whole week to just get the tranny opened up to figure out the problem because the 3 -4 band was melted to the case. Now I thought that band also controlled second gear and I had perfect use of second gear wich doesn't make any sense to me.

Supposedly everything else in the tranny was still good except for the 3-4 clutches and he wants to charge me $1500.00 to replace them after I just spent $2800.00 six months ago for the tranny.
